微信扫码
添加专属顾问
我要投稿
Claude Code的SKILLs功能将AI从简单的对话工具升级为可执行复杂任务的专家团队,彻底改变了开发者的工作方式。 核心内容: 1. Claude SKILLs的核心价值:消除重复提示工程,解决上下文腐烂问题 2. SKILLs的三大组成部分:精确指令、参考文件和可执行脚本 3. 实际应用案例:从PDF提取到自动化部署的多样化场景
Claude Code 可能是人类创造的第一个通用 AI 智能体 (Agent)。真正的突破在于 Claude Code 能够编写精确的代码来对其“思想”采取“行动”。这一突破的关键推动因素是 Agent SKILLs[1],即包含指令、参考资料和可执行脚本的可重用包,它们将 Claude 变成了始终如一的强大专家。
社区在 X (Twitter) 上对 Claude SKILLs 反响热烈:
Claude Skills 是我用过的最好的功能。 — @godofprompt[2]
如果你没有为 Claude 配备 Skills,你就错过了它 90% 的能力。 — @boringmarketer[3]
别忽视 Skills。Skills 绝对是驾驭 Claude Code 最有效的方法之一。 — @omarsar0[4]
SKILLs 消除了重复的提示词工程 (prompting),解决了上下文腐烂 (context rot) 问题,并解锁了确定的、配备工具的工作流,感觉就像拥有了一支专家 Agent 团队。
Claude Agent SKILL 是一个结构化的、可重用的包,存储在你项目的 .claude/skills/ 文件夹中。它结合了以下内容:
以下是一些流行的 SKILLs 示例:
用户经常要求 Claude Code 自己生成新的 SKILLs,然后手动进行微调——这使得迭代速度非常快。
顶级的 Claude Agent SKILLs 远不止是指令。它们包含了针对那些要求一致性任务的脚本。
例如,一个简单的提示词“从这个 PDF 中提取数据”可能会产生幻觉或遗漏表格。而一个包含使用 pypdf 或 PyMuPDF 的 Python 脚本的 SKILL 则能保证每次都获得准确、可重复的结果。
其他常见的脚本化 SKILLs 包括:
Claude Code 可以自主执行这些 SKILL 脚本。
SKILL 脚本,尤其是 Python 或 JavaScript 脚本,通常需要第三方库和依赖项。Claude Code 很聪明。当它看到 ModuleNotFoundError 时,它会进行推理,并自行运行 pip install 或 npm install。这对于原型设计来说非常神奇。
但在你的本机环境上,这很快就会产生问题:
Santiago Víquez Jul 6, 2023 我这一代最聪明的大脑都在思考如何安装 Python。
"Chris Albon Jul 5, 2023 在新的 M2 MacBook 上安装 Python 的“正确方法”是什么?我假设不是系统自带的 Python3 对吧?也许是 Homebrew?"
对于严肃的基于 SKILL 的 Agent ,你需要隔离环境。
Docker[5] Sandboxes(Docker Desktop[6] 4.50+ 中的实验性功能)正是为像 Claude Code 这样的 Agent 构建的。它允许你运行具有完全自主权的 Claude,同时保持你的宿主机一尘不染。 只需一条命令即可安全启动一切:
docker sandbox run claude
运行该命令时会发生以下情况:
Docker SandBoxes 的官方基础镜像已经安装有常用的软件运行时:
每个工作区一个沙箱:在同一目录中再次运行该命令会恢复现有容器,保留所有已安装的包、临时文件和状态。非常适合在多个会话中演进复杂的 SKILLs。
假设你的 PDF 提取 SKILL 失败并显示: Plaintext
ModuleNotFoundError: No module named 'pymupdf'
Claude Code 看到错误并安装:
pip install pymupdf
就是这样了。你不需要做任何事情。该软件包仅存在于沙箱中。你的主机保持未被接触。下一次会话(在同一文件夹中),它已经可用了。
现在,你最好不要完全依赖 Claude 来安装软件,因为这个过程对人类来说很容易遵循,但仅看错误信息可能会让大语言模型(LLM)感到困惑。使用标准的 Docker 命令,你可以简单地登录到容器中并自己手动运行安装步骤。
docker sandbox ls # 找到你的沙箱 ID
docker exec -it <id> /bin/bash
安装各种东西,无论是系统包、小众二进制文件还是自定义工具。更改将在不同会话之间持久保存。
一旦你尝试了许多 SKILLs 并生成了许多具有复杂依赖的项目,容器中的环境可能仍然会变得杂乱。你可以简单地重新开始。
docker sandbox rm <id>
然后重新运行:
docker sandbox run claude
即可获得一个挂载了你代码的干净容器。
53AI,企业落地大模型首选服务商
产品:场景落地咨询+大模型应用平台+行业解决方案
承诺:免费POC验证,效果达标后再合作。零风险落地应用大模型,已交付160+中大型企业
2026-03-08
ChatGPT 5.4 与 OpenClaw 驱动下的 SaaS 市场重构与未来演进
2026-03-08
GPT-5.4、Claude、Gemini三方混战:AI Agent native能力终极PK
2026-03-08
如果微信全面 AI 化了,会有什么后果?
2026-03-07
Claude Code 推出 /loop 无限循环,一台电脑即可化身无数小龙虾
2026-03-07
你花真金白银买的第三方API,有一半都是假的
2026-03-07
Xiaomi miclaw,小米移动端 Agent 开启小范围封测
2026-03-06
刚刚!小米手机可以养小龙虾🦞了
2026-03-06
GPT-5.4实测全记录,当我让它操控我的电脑微信...
2026-01-24
2026-01-10
2026-01-01
2026-01-26
2025-12-09
2025-12-21
2026-01-09
2026-01-09
2025-12-30
2026-01-27
2026-03-08
2026-03-03
2026-03-01
2026-02-27
2026-02-27
2026-02-26
2026-02-24
2026-02-24